What is Somatropin?

Genotropin Miniquick is a subcutaneous use somatropin solution for growth hormone replacement. It is designed for convenient administration and is manufactured by Pfizer Aps in the EU.

What is Somatropin used for?

Genotropin Miniquick is primarily used for growth hormone replacement therapy. It is often prescribed to address growth hormone deficiencies in both children and adults. The solution is designed for subcutaneous use, making it easier to administer. What is Genotropin Miniquick used for? It is commonly used to promote growth in children who do not produce enough natural growth hormone and to manage growth hormone deficiencies in adults.

What are the side effects of Somatropin?

Common effects of Genotropin Miniquick may include redness, swelling, or itching at the injection site. Some users might experience joint pain, muscle pain, or headaches. These effects are generally mild and temporary. It is important to monitor for any persistent or severe reactions and consult a healthcare provider if necessary.

What precautions apply to Somatropin?

Genotropin Miniquick should be handled with care and stored as directed to maintain its effectiveness. It is important to follow the prescribed dosage and administration instructions provided by a healthcare professional. Always check the solution for any particles or discoloration before use. Ensure that the injection site is clean to minimize the risk of infection.

What does Somatropin interact with?

Genotropin Miniquick may interact with certain medications, including corticosteroids, thyroid hormones, and insulin. It is important to inform your healthcare provider about all medications you are taking to avoid potential interactions. Alcohol and other substances may also affect the efficacy of the treatment.
